Canon vs NAURA Technology
NAURA Technology is larger by market cap ($81.9B vs $24.2B). Canon reports higher tracked revenue ($29.1B vs $5.8B). Canon's primary segment is Lithography; NAURA Technology's is Etch.
Shared segment: Equipment (Front End).
